“Just because someone carries it well doesn’t mean it isn’t heavy.” This quote, spoken by Alek Wek, is a reminder that we should never judge someone by their appearance. It is easy to assume that if someone looks put together and confident, they must have an easy life. But the reality is that everyone has struggles and challenges to face, no matter how they may look on the outside.

The Pressure to Appear Perfect

The Pressure To Appear Perfect

In today’s society, there is a tremendous pressure to appear perfect. Social media platforms like Instagram and Facebook only exacerbate this issue, as people are constantly bombarded with images of seemingly perfect lives. It can be difficult to remember that these images are often carefully curated and edited, and that they do not represent the full reality of a person’s life.

As a result, many people feel like they have to put on a façade of perfection in order to be accepted by society. They may feel like they cannot show weakness or vulnerability, as this would be seen as a sign of failure. This pressure to appear perfect can be incredibly damaging to a person’s mental health and well-being.

The Weight of Mental Health Issues

The Weight Of Mental Health Issues

One of the heaviest things that someone can carry is the weight of mental health issues. Depression, anxiety, and other mental health disorders can be incredibly challenging to deal with, and they can be invisible to the outside world. Just because someone appears happy and put together on the outside does not mean that they are not struggling on the inside.

It is important to remember that mental health issues are just as valid and important as physical health issues. Just because someone does not have a physical ailment does not mean that they are not dealing with significant challenges.

The Burden of Caregiving

The Burden Of Caregiving

Another heavy burden that someone may carry is the weight of caregiving. Taking care of a sick or elderly loved one can be incredibly challenging, both physically and emotionally. It can be difficult to balance the needs of the person being cared for with one’s own needs.

Caregiving can also be isolating, as it can be difficult to find time to socialize or pursue one’s own interests. Just because someone appears to be handling caregiving well does not mean that they are not struggling with the weight of this responsibility.

The Struggle of Addiction

The Struggle Of Addiction

Finally, addiction is another heavy burden that someone may carry. Addiction can be incredibly isolating, and it can be difficult to reach out for help. Just because someone appears to be functioning well on the outside does not mean that they are not struggling with addiction.

It is important to remember that addiction is a disease, and it requires treatment and support in order to overcome. Just because someone is struggling with addiction does not mean that they are weak or have failed in some way.
